/* * Copyright 2007 ZXing authors * * Licensed under the Apache License, Version 2.0 (the "License"); * you may not use this file except in compliance with the License. * You may obtain a copy of the License at * * http://www.apache.org/licenses/LICENSE-2.0 * * Unless required by applicable law or agreed to in writing, software * distributed under the License is distributed on an "AS IS" BASIS, * W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ied. * See the License for the specific language governing permissions and * limitations under the License. */ //package com.google.zxing; use std::collections::HashSet; use crate::{BarcodeFormat, PointCallback}; #[cfg(feature = "serde")] use serde::{Deserialize, Serialize}; /** * Encapsulates a type of hint that a caller may pass to a barcode reader to help it * more quickly or accurately decode it. It is up to implementations to decide what, * if anything, to do with the information that is supplied. * * @author Sean Owen * @author dswitkin@google.com (Daniel Switkin) * @see Reader#decode(BinaryBitmap,java.util.Map) */ #[cfg_attr(feature = "serde", derive(Serialize, Deserialize))] #[derive(Eq, PartialEq, Hash, Debug, Clone, Copy)] pub enum DecodeHintType { /** * Unspecified, application-specific hint. Maps to an unspecified {@link Object}. */ OTHER, /** * Image is a pure monochrome image of a barcode. Doesn't matter what it maps to; * use {@link Boolean#TRUE}. */ PURE_BARCODE, /** * Image is known to be of one of a few possible formats. * Maps to a {@link List} of {@link BarcodeFormat}s. */ POSSIBLE_FORMATS, /** * Spend more time to try to find a barcode; optimize for accuracy, not speed. * Doesn't matter what it maps to; use {@link Boolean#TRUE}. */ TRY_HARDER, /** * Specifies what character encoding to use when decoding, where applicable (type String) */ CHARACTER_SET, /** * Allowed lengths of encoded data -- reject anything else. Maps to an {@code int[]}. */ ALLOWED_LENGTHS, /** * Assume Code 39 codes employ a check digit. Doesn't matter what it maps to; * use {@link Boolean#TRUE}. */ ASSUME_CODE_39_CHECK_DIGIT, /** * Assume the barcode is being processed as a GS1 barcode, and modify behavior as needed. * For example this affects FNC1 handling for Code 128 (aka GS1-128). Doesn't matter what it maps to; * use {@link Boolean#TRUE}. */ ASSUME_GS1, /** * If true, return the start and end digits in a Codabar barcode instead of stripping them. They * are alpha, whereas the rest are numeric. By default, they are stripped, but this causes them * to not be. Doesn't matter what it maps to; use {@link Boolean#TRUE}. */ RETURN_CODABAR_START_END, /** * The caller needs to be notified via callback when a possible {@link Point} * is found. Maps to a {@link PointCallback}. */ NEED_RESULT_POINT_CALLBACK, /** * Allowed extension lengths for EAN or UPC barcodes. Other formats will ignore this. * Maps to an {@code int[]} of the allowed extension lengths, for example [2], [5], or [2, 5]. * If it is optional to have an extension, do not set this hint. If this is set, * and a UPC or EAN barcode is found but an extension is not, then no result will be returned * at all. */ ALLOWED_EAN_EXTENSIONS, /** * If true, also tries to decode as inverted image. All configured decoders are simply called a * second time with an inverted image. Doesn't matter what it maps to; use {@link Boolean#TRUE}. */ ALSO_INVERTED, /** * Specifies that the codes are expected to be in conformance with the specification * ISO/IEC 18004 regading the interpretation of character encoding. Values encoded in BYTE mode * or in KANJI mode are interpreted as ISO-8859-1 characters unless an ECI specified at a prior * location in the input specified a different encoding. By default the encoding of BYTE encoded * values is determinied by the {@link #CHARACTER_SET} hint or otherwise by a heuristic that * examines the bytes. By default KANJI encoded values are interpreted as the bytes of Shift-JIS * encoded characters (note that this is the case even if an ECI specifies a different * encoding). */ #[cfg(feature = "allow_forced_iso_ied_18004_compliance")] QR_ASSUME_SPEC_CONFORM_INPUT, /* * Data type the hint is expecting. * Among the possible values the {@link Void} stands out as being used for * hints that do not expect a value to be supplied (flag hints). Such hints * will possibly have their value ignored, or replaced by a * {@link Boolean#TRUE}. Hint suppliers should probably use * {@link Boolean#TRUE} as directed by the actual hint documentation. */ /* private final Class valueType; DecodeHintType(Class valueType) { this.valueType = valueType; } public Class getValueType() { return valueType; }*/ } #[cfg_attr(feature = "serde", derive(Serialize, Deserialize))] #[derive(Clone)] pub enum DecodeHintValue { /** * Unspecified, application-specific hint.
